Brunel appeared on a circulating £2 coin from 2006 as part of the Royal Mint's ongoing biographical series, with this gold proof struck as the collector version of that base-metal issue. The choice of Brunel was uncontroversial — he had topped a BBC public poll in 2002 ranking the greatest Britons, finishing second only to Churchill, which effectively handed the Royal Mint a ready-made justification for the commission.
The .9167 fineness is standard 22-carat crown gold, the same alloy the Royal Mint has used for sovereign-series coinage since 1817.
